Output 879ee81cd1c6a17d35c19664fc4a2f486227e4115ed10c76f1046122bd9af11b:76

value
2067263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d13332bb1b0d88b5a0d4b543fe6d69957b8a53c OP_EQUAL
address
35oMLCzTb5D3nXADzZ2AwqWdKMBRYF5qiP
transaction
879ee81cd1c6a17d35c19664fc4a2f486227e4115ed10c76f1046122bd9af11b
spent
true